Who owns the Xiaomi brand: the structure of the company
Officially, Xiaomi Inc. is a Chinese public company registered in Beijing, and its founder and current CEO is Lei Jun, who is a Chinese company based in Beijing. 2010 In the past year, a team of former employees of Google China, Kingsoft and Motorola has assembled.-3 Global smartphone manufacturers, according to Counterpoint Research (2026 A year behind only Samsung and Apple.
But the company doesn't own the plants. Instead, it uses a model. ODM/OEM (Original Design Manufacturer/Original Equipment Manufacturer: when:
- 🏭 Xiaomi is developing design, firmware (MIUI) technical requirements;
- 🤝 Transfers drawings and specifications to manufacturing partners;
- 📦 Partners assemble devices under the Xiaomi brand and deliver them to the company’s warehouse.
This allows Xiaomi to focus on marketing, software development and the ecosystem (Mi Home, HyperOS) without spending resources on plant maintenance. But who are these mysterious partners?

Geography of production: where to assemble Xiaomi in 2026
While in 2015, 99% of Xiaomi’s devices were assembled in China, today the picture is different, and the company is moving production to other countries to:
- 🌍 Lower logistics costs (e.g., assembly in India for the local market is cheaper than imports from China);
- 💰 Circumvent trade duties (in India on imported smartphones – 20% tax);
- 🤝 Comply with government requirements (e.g., Indonesia has a 40% localization rule for electronics).
Here is the current map of Xiaomi’s production capacity as of 2026:

Xiaomi vs. competitors: how to produce smartphones
Unlike Xiaomi, other giants in the market use different production models.
| Brand | Model of production | Key plants | Advantages | Deficiencies |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Apple | Contract manufacturing (Foxconn, Pegatron, Wistron) | China (70%), India (20%), Brazil (10%) | High quality control, innovation | High prices, dependence on China |
| Samsung | Own plants + ODM | Vietnam (50%), India (30%), Korea (10%), Brazil (10%) | Flexibility and vertical integration | Expensive production of flagships |
| Realme/Oppo | ODM (Wingtech, Huaqin) | China (80%), India (15%), Indonesia (5%) | Low prices, quick release of models | Low Differentiation of Products |
| Xiaomi | ODM/OEM (Foxconn, BYD, Wingtech) | China (60%), India (30%), other (10%) | Low prices, wide range | Different build quality, dependence on partners |
